Study TitleCharacterizing commonalities and differences between the breast and prostate cancer metabotypes in African-American cohorts (part I)
Study TypeIdentify Breast Cancer Progression and Prostate Cancer correlative Metabolite Markers
Study SummaryThus, we aimed to 1) understand mechanisms related to the onset and progression of BCa, 2) identify precursors and targets for prevention and therapy for each stage, grade and subtype which may contribute to the disparate impact of BCa in African American women, and 3) Identify common and different BCa metabolite markers versus PCa markers.
